Part Overview
The Amphenol ICC 68024-116 is a rectangular connector header featuring 16 vertical positions with 0.100" (2.54mm) pitch spacing. This through-hole component is part of the BERGSTIK® II series and is designed for board-to-board applications with solder termination. Substitute Part Grouping Explanation
Substitution eligibility for the 68024-116 is determined by the following critical parameters that must align with the original specification:
Primary Matching Criteria:
- Pitch - Mating: 0.100" (2.54mm) — exact match required
- Number of Positions: 16 — exact match required
- Contact Type: Male Pin — exact match required
- Mounting Type: Through Hole — exact match required
- Termination: Solder — exact match required
- Style: Board to Board or Board to Board/Cable compatible
- Shrouding: Unshrouded — exact match required
- Contact Shape: Square — exact match required
- Material Flammability Rating: UL94 V-0 — minimum requirement
Secondary Compatibility Parameters:
- Contact Finish - Mating: Gold-based finishes acceptable
- Insulation Color: Black — standard specification
- MSL Rating: 1 (Unlimited) — compatible with original
The substitute part 6-146276-6 (TE Connectivity AMP Connectors, AMPMODU Mod II series) meets all primary and secondary matching criteria and is therefore a direct functional equivalent for the 68024-116.

Engineering Selection Recommendations
Primary Selection: 68024-116 (Amphenol ICC)
The original 68024-116 remains the preferred component for applications where the BERGSTIK® II series specification is required. This part maintains active product status with established supply availability. However, RoHS non-compliance may restrict use in regulated markets or applications subject to environmental compliance mandates.
Alternative Selection: 6-146276-6 (TE Connectivity)
The 6-146276-6 serves as a functional equivalent for applications requiring ROHS3 compliance. This substitute maintains identical pitch, position count, contact type, and mounting configuration. The part is active with higher inventory availability (3025 units). The AMPMODU Mod II series provides board-to-board or cable compatibility, offering expanded application flexibility compared to the board-to-board-only configuration of the original part.
Compliance Considerations:
Selection between these parts depends on regulatory requirements. Applications subject to RoHS3 directives must use 6-146276-6. Applications without RoHS compliance requirements may use either part based on supply chain and cost considerations.
Physical Dimension Variance:
Minor differences exist in contact post length (0.150" vs. 0.125") and insulation height (0.100" vs. 0.090"). These variations are within acceptable tolerances for standard board-to-board interconnect applications but should be verified against specific PCB design requirements.
Frequently Asked Questions (FAQ)
Q: Can 6-146276-6 be used as a direct replacement for 68024-116?
A: Yes. Both parts share identical pitch (0.100"/2.54mm), position count (16), contact type (male pin), mounting method (through hole), and termination (solder). The mating contact length is identical at 0.318" (8.08mm). Minor differences in post length and insulation height do not affect standard board-to-board interconnect functionality.
Q: What is the primary difference between these two parts?
A: The 6-146276-6 is ROHS3 compliant, while the 68024-116 is RoHS non-compliant. The substitute also offers board-to-cable compatibility in addition to board-to-board configuration. Contact material differs (copper alloy vs. phosphor bronze), and contact finish thickness on the mating surface is reduced (15.0µin vs. 30.0µin).
Q: Are there any mechanical compatibility issues when substituting?
A: The contact post length differs by 0.025" (0.63mm), and insulation height differs by 0.010" (0.254mm). These variations are minor and compatible with standard PCB design tolerances. Applications with tight mechanical constraints should verify these dimensions against specific board specifications.
Q: Which part should be selected for new designs?
A: For new designs subject to RoHS3 compliance requirements, specify 6-146276-6. For applications without RoHS compliance mandates, either part is acceptable based on supply chain and cost optimization. Both parts maintain active product status with established availability.
Q: What is the operating temperature range for these connectors?
A: The 68024-116 does not specify an operating temperature range in the provided data. The 6-146276-6 operates across -65°C to 105°C, which covers standard industrial and commercial temperature ranges.
Q: Are these parts suitable for high-current applications?
A: The 6-146276-6 is rated for 3A continuous current. The 68024-116 does not specify a current rating. Applications requiring current capacity verification should reference detailed electrical specifications or contact the manufacturer directly.
